About

  • The Captain will take you through the marina and out the Harbor to explore the famous Cabo San Lucas Bay doing the traditional tour to the arch , Cabo's Famous landmark. The iconic rock Archway ( El Arco ) at the tip of the peninsula of Baja California , it marks The Lands End. This is Cabos, the most recognized destination in Mexico . The point where the 2 seas get toghether Pacific and Sea of Cortez .

  • Dare to navigate the Bay of Cabo San Lucas, on this tour to the end of the earth, passing through the Lover´s Beach, Pelican Rock, The Pirate's Cave, the pacific window, while admiring the marine fauna of Cabo. the 3 hours tour offerce you the option of visiting Chileno bay or Santa María beach.

History

Cabo San Lucas was once a bustling pirate hub and trading port before becoming a world-renowned tourist destination.
